Objectives
Take a Water Pitcher from the water well.
Return the pitcher to Chief Hawkwind in Camp Narache which is northwest from the water well.
Description
I have traveled many paths through life and these old legs lack the vigor they once had. I can still perform my duties to the tribe. Sometimes it just takes an old woman a little longer to do the task.
But you look like an eager <class>. Let's put some of that youthful vitality to the test. Take a water pitcher from the well and bring it to my son, the Chief, in Camp Narache.
Remember that even the most humble task can gain the recognition of elders.
